Verona, located in Dane County, Wisconsin, is a charming city that blends small-town charm with modern amenities. Known for its community-oriented atmosphere, beautiful parks, and a strong school system, Verona is an ideal place for families and individuals alike. This article explores the best residential areas in Verona, highlighting their characteristics, housing options, average prices, and what makes them unique.

    Downtown Verona



    Downtown Verona

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Downtown Verona is the vibrant center of the city, offering a mix of local shops, restaurants, and recreational facilities. It reflects the city's community spirit and provides access to various events and activities throughout the year.



    Characteristics of the Downtown Verona

    * Culture: A vibrant arts scene with local galleries and theaters, community events, and farmer’s markets.

    * Transportation: Well connected by public transit and within walking distance to many amenities.

    * Services: Restaurants, boutiques, grocery stores, and public libraries are readily available.

    * Environment: Lively and community-oriented, especially during events.


    Housing Options in the Downtown Verona

    Single-family homes, townhomes, and apartments.


    Average Home Prices in the Downtown Verona

    * Buying: $300,000 – $450,000

    * Renting: $1,200 – $1,800/month



    Verona Woods



    Verona Woods

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Verona Woods is a peaceful, master-planned community situated amidst nature, featuring spacious lots and a variety of architectural styles. It is ideal for families and individuals looking for a suburban lifestyle with easy access to outdoor activities.



    Characteristics of the Verona Woods

    * Culture: Focus on nature and recreation with community parks and walking trails.

    * Transportation: Car is recommended; however, there are some paths for biking and walking.

    * Services: Nearby schools, parks, and grocery stores.

    * Environment: Family-friendly with a tranquil suburban feel.


    Housing Options in the Verona Woods

    Single-family homes and new construction.


    Average Home Prices in the Verona Woods

    * Buying: $350,000 – $500,000

    * Renting: $1,500 – $2,200/month
